The Exception

Just as I finally fully fathomed, That the exception does indeed prove the rule. They went and changed the rule, And now the exception is no longer the exception. Now instead of being the exception, I take exception. When the majority is the minority, And the minority rules the majority, The new rule makes majority rule, the exception, That proves the new rule and makes me take exception. Which is something I find hard to Fathom. I hope that I can have it fathomed, Before the new rule, Becomes an old rule, And the exception that was an exception, Is no longer an exception, Making the rule beyond my ability to Fathom. In the meantime If you can find the time, And your memory does not let you down, I suggest you tone it down, And avoid joining the majority, As to become part of the minority, Seems to be the only way to not become the exception to the rule, So, you can stand in the minority and you too can rule, While I go away and do some more fathoming.
